Ingredients You Need
- 4 medium apples: Choose a variety like Honeycrisp or Granny Smith for a balance of sweetness and tartness.
- 2 tablespoons brown sugar: This adds a rich, caramel flavor.
- 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on: A key ingredient that offers a warm, spicy aroma.
- 1 tablespoon lemon juice: Helps to prevent the apples from browning and adds a touch of acidity.
- 1 tablespoon butter, melted: Enhances flavor and promotes browning during cooking.
- Optional: vanilla ice cream: A scoop on top makes this dessert extra indulgent.
How to Make Air Fryer Apples and Cinnamon Step by Step
- Start by peeling, coring, and slicing the apples into even wedges.
- In a large bowl, toss the apple slices with lemon juice, brown sugar, cinnamon, and melted butter until well coated.
- Preheat your air fryer to 350°F (180°C) for about 5 minutes.
- Place the coated apple slices in the air fryer basket in a single layer. You may need to do this in batches.
- Cook for 10-12 minutes, shaking the basket halfway through to ensure even cooking.
- Once done, remove the apples from the air fryer and let them cool for a few minutes before serving.
Pro Tip: Ensure your apple slices are of uniform thickness for even cooking.
Pro Tip: Check the apples at the 10-minute mark for desired tenderness.
Expert Tips for Best Results
- Choose apples that are firm and crisp for the best texture.
- Experiment with different types of cinnamon, such as Ceylon or Saigon, for varied flavors.
- For a nutty flavor, consider adding chopped walnuts or pecans to the apple mixture.
- Serve the apples warm for the best taste experience.
- Pair with caramel sauce or a drizzle of honey for added sweetness.
-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
Variations and Substitutions
- Gluten-Free Option: This recipe is naturally gluten-free.
- Dairy-Free: Substitute melted butter with coconut oil or a dairy-free margarine.
- Spiced Version: Add a pinch of nutmeg or ginger for a spicier flavor.
- Seasonal Fruits: Substitute apples with pears or peaches in the summer for a different twist.
How to Serve and Store
Serve your air fryer apples warm, optionally topped with a scoop of vanilla ice cream or whipped cream for an extra indulgence. You can also sprinkle some extra cinnamon on top for added flavor. In terms of storage, these apples can be kept in the fridge for up to 3 days in an airtight container. While freezing is not recommended due to texture changes, you can reheat leftovers in the air fryer for a few minutes to enjoy them warm again.
Frequently Asked Questions
Can I use different types of apples for this recipe?
Yes, you can use any firm apple variety, such as Fuji, Gala, or Braeburn.
How can I make this recipe sugar-free?
Use a sugar substitute like erythritol or stevia in place of brown sugar.
What is the best way to reheat leftover apples?
The best method is to reheat them in the air fryer for 3-5 minutes at 350°F (180°C).
Can I add nuts to the recipe?
Yes, adding chopped walnuts or pecans enhances the flavor and provides a nice crunch.
Is this recipe suitable for meal prep?
Absolutely! You can prepare the apples in advance and cook them when ready to serve.
What other spices can I use besides cinnamon?
You can experiment with nutmeg, ginger, or even pumpkin spice for a different flavor profile.

Description
Deliciously tender and caramelized air fryer apples sprinkled with cinnamon, perfect for a quick dessert or snack.
Ingredients
- 4 medium apples, peeled, cored, and sliced
- 2 tablespoons brown sugar
- 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on
- 1 tablespoon lemon juice
- 1 tablespoon butter, melted
- Optional: vanilla ice cream for serving
Instructions
- Preheat your air fryer to 350°F (175°C).
- In a large bowl, combine the sliced apples, brown sugar, ground cinnamon, lemon juice, and melted butter. Toss until the apples are well coated.
- Place the coated apples in the air fryer basket in a single layer. You may need to do this in batches depending on the size of your air fryer.
- Air fry the apples at 350°F for 10-12 minutes, shaking the basket halfway through to ensure even cooking.
- Once the apples are tender and caramelized, remove them from the air fryer.
- Serve warm, optionally topped with vanilla ice cream.
